Vaccinium corymbosum ‘Cabernet Splash’, commonly known as ‘Cabernet Splash’ variegated blueberry, is a deciduous fruit shrub with a compact, upright habit, sought after as much for its production as for its distinctive ornamental foliage. Its young shoots emerge deep wine red, then develop into green foliage variegated with cream, creating a bright contrast throughout the season. In spring, it produces pinkish-white, nectar-rich bell-shaped flowers, followed in summer by firm, juicy, dark blue blueberries with a sweet and well-balanced flavor. Although slightly less productive than some classic varieties, it compensates with its high ornamental value in beds or containers. Its foliage turns intense red in autumn. Vaccinium corymbosum ‘Cabernet Splash’ requires acidic, rich, and well-drained soil.
